Expansion Valve: Service and Repair
Thermostatic Expansion Valve

THERMOSTATIC EXPANSION VALVE

Removal and Installation

NOTE:  Installation of a new receiver/drier cartridge is not required when repairing the air conditioning system except when there is physical evidence
of system contamination from a failed A/C compressor or damage to the receiver/drier cartridge.

1. Recover the refrigerant.
2. Disconnect the A/C pressure transducer electrical connector and detach the wire harness from the thermostatic expansion valve (TXV) stud.
3. Remove the TXV fitting nut and disconnect the fitting.

-

Discard the gasket seals.

-

To install, tighten to 15 Nm (11 lb-ft).

4. Remove the 2 TXV bolts.
5. Remove the TXV.

-

Discard the gasket seals.

6. To install, reverse the removal procedure.

-

Install new gasket seals.

-

Lubricate the refrigerant system with the correct amount of clean PAG oil.

7. Evacuate, leak test and charge the refrigerant system.
